Book excerpt: Includes photographs inside and out of over 40 Mediterranean revival homes in Florida, inspired by classic Spanish, Italian, and Moorish designs. Architects include Addison Mizner, Maurice Fatio, Marion Sims Wyeth, John Volk, James Gamble Rogers II, Richard Kiehnel, John Elliot, and Henry Taylor.

Book excerpt: This book takes a simple look at homes in the past, highlighting the diversity of homes that people lived in around the world at different times. Homes featured include Roman houses, castles, Native American earth lodges, stately homes, and city dwellings from around the world in times past. Throughout the book, simple leveled text supports bright and engaging photographs, and the book also includes a picture glossary of difficult and important words, and notes for parents and teachers with advice on how to use the book.

Book excerpt: From Aragon, Galicia, and the Basque regions in the north to the central cities of Madrid and Toledo, from the fabled Andalusian cities of Seville and Granada in the south to the Catalan capital, Barcelona, more than thirty enchanting and historically significant properties are visited in this landmark volume. The lavish illustrations depict the wide range of design styles embraced by Spaniards over the centuries, reflecting the fascinating motifs of the numerous cultures that have contributed to the Spanish aesthetic. Imposing medieval castillos, fabulously detailed Moorish-influenced country casas, and beautifully furnished, art-filled city palacios are included in this tour of the country's grand and historic private residences and buildings
